计算机视觉异常检测技术是近年来人工智能领域的一个重要研究方向,它结合了计算机视觉和机器学习的技术优势,为工业、医疗、安防等领域的实际问题提供了高效的解决方案。本文将从异常检测的定义、技术方法以及应用场景三个方面对这一技术进行深入探讨。
计算机视觉异常检测是一种利用计算机视觉技术来识别图像或视频中与正常模式不一致的异常现象的方法。在现实生活中,异常通常是指偏离常规的行为或状态,例如生产线上的产品缺陷、监控视频中的可疑人员活动或医学影像中的病灶区域。通过分析大量的正常数据样本,计算机视觉异常检测模型能够学习到“正常”的特征,并在此基础上识别出任何不符合这些特征的现象。
传统的异常检测方法主要依赖于人工设计的规则或阈值,但这种方法往往受限于特定场景,且难以适应复杂的非线性数据分布。而基于深度学习的计算机视觉异常检测技术则能够自动提取高维特征,显著提升了检测精度和泛化能力。
生成模型是一类通过学习数据分布来生成新样本的模型,常见的包括变分自编码器(VAE)和生成对抗网络(GAN)。在异常检测中,生成模型可以用来重构输入数据。如果输入数据是正常的,模型可以较好地还原其内容;但如果输入数据包含异常,则模型的重构误差会显著增加。通过计算重构误差,我们可以判断数据是否属于异常类别。
基于分类的异常检测方法假设我们有一个标记好的训练集,其中包含正常和异常样本。通过训练一个分类器(如支持向量机、神经网络),模型可以直接预测新数据属于正常还是异常类别。
聚类方法通过将数据划分为多个簇来发现异常点。正常数据通常聚集在一起形成密集的簇,而异常数据则远离这些簇。K-Means、DBSCAN等算法常被用于此类任务。
对于涉及时间序列的视频数据,异常检测可以通过分析帧间的变化来实现。例如,光流法可以捕捉物体运动轨迹,而卷积长短时记忆网络(ConvLSTM)可以建模时空特征。这些方法特别适合检测动态场景中的异常行为。
在制造业中,产品质量是企业的生命线。传统的质量检测依赖于人工检查,效率低下且容易出错。而基于计算机视觉的异常检测系统可以通过摄像头实时采集产品图像,快速识别表面划痕、形状偏差等问题,从而大幅提高生产效率和产品质量。
医学影像中的异常检测是一个关键任务,例如CT扫描中的肿瘤识别或X光片中的骨折检测。通过训练深度学习模型,医生可以更快地定位病变区域,减少漏诊率并提高诊断准确性。
在公共场所的安全监控中,异常行为检测尤为重要。例如,当有人在禁区内徘徊、翻越围墙或遗留危险物品时,系统可以及时发出警报,协助安保人员采取行动。
自动驾驶汽车需要对周围环境进行实时感知,以避免潜在的危险。异常检测技术可以帮助车辆识别道路上的障碍物、行人或其他异常情况,确保行驶安全。
在城市管理和零售行业中,视频监控系统广泛应用于人流统计、顾客行为分析等领域。通过检测异常行为(如偷窃、打架等),可以为管理者提供决策支持。
计算机视觉异常检测技术已经从理论研究逐步走向实际应用,成为推动社会智能化的重要工具。尽管该技术在性能上取得了显著进步,但仍面临诸多挑战,例如数据标注困难、模型解释性不足以及计算资源限制等问题。未来,随着深度学习算法的进一步发展以及硬件性能的提升,相信计算机视觉异常检测将在更多领域发挥更大作用,为人类生活带来便利和安全保障。
公司:赋能智赢信息资讯传媒(深圳)有限公司
地址:深圳市龙岗区龙岗街道平南社区龙岗路19号东森商业大厦(东嘉国际)5055A15
Q Q:3874092623
Copyright © 2022-2025